ENDOSCOPE
20230000318 · 2023-01-05 · ·

An endoscope includes a distal end portion main body arranged at a distal end portion of an insertion portion, the distal end portion main body including a recess, the distal end portion main body including at least one screw hole in at least one of a periphery of the recess or an interior of the recess, a lid configured to cover an opening of the recess, the lid including at least one through-hole at a position corresponding to the screw hole, a resin configured to fill a gap between the lid and the distal end portion main body, at least one screw configured to fix the lid to the distal end portion main body, the screw being inserted through the through-hole and screwed into the screw hole, at least one screw cover having an insulation property and configured to cover an upper surface of the screw, the screw cover being disposed closer to a proximal end side than to the recess, and a distal end cover configured to cover a part of the distal end portion main body.

ELECTRONIC MODULE, METHOD OF MANUFACTURING ELECTRONIC MODULE, AND ENDOSCOPE
20230007769 · 2023-01-05 · ·

An electronic module includes a three-dimensional wiring board including a cavity portion in which a bottom surface and four wall surfaces are formed, a plurality of electrodes being provided on the bottom surface, and a plurality of electronic components mounted on the plurality of electrodes and including a plurality of chip components and an image pickup module configured to pick up an image in an opening section direction of the cavity portion. A wall surface among the four wall surfaces that corresponds to a direction in which the plurality of chip components are arrayed is an inclined surface having an inclination with respect to the bottom surface.

COVER MEMBER AND TREATMENT INSTRUMENT
20230000324 · 2023-01-05 · ·

A cover member includes: a sheath that is formed in a cylindrical shape for receiving a shaft; and a tubular portion that is attached to a distal end of the sheath. The tubular portion being formed such that an outer dimension of a distal end portion of the tubular portion in a first direction is smaller than an outer dimension of a proximal end portion of the tubular portion in the first direction and/or an outer dimension of the distal end portion in a second direction is smaller than an outer dimension of the proximal end portion in the second direction.

Endoscopic suturing system

An endoscopic suturing system and method are disclosed as are devices for use with the system and method such as a suture dispenser, a cinch device, and a tissue grasper. In one embodiment the suturing system includes a cap assembly arranged at the distal end portion of an endoscope or guide member, with the cap assembly including a rotatable needle holder. The needle holder is actuated through a transmission element extending outside the endoscope or guide member. A needle capture device may be inserted through a channel of the endoscope or guide member in order to capture a needle held in the needle holder when the needle holder is rotated so that the needle punctures tissue.

Methods and apparatus for removing material from within a mammalian cavity using an insertable endoscopic instrument

An endoscope for removing tissue at a surgical site includes an elongated tubular body insertable within a mammalian cavity of a patient. An instrument channel extends between a first opening at a distal end and a second opening at a proximal end of the tubular body and is sized and configured to receive a surgical cutting assembly that includes an aspiration channel configured to remove material entering the endoscope via a distal end of the surgical cutting assembly. A torque generation component configured to generate torque is positioned within the distal end and configured to provide the generated torque to a coupling component. The coupling component is positioned at the distal end of the elongated tubular member and configured to actuate a cutting component of the surgical cutting assembly responsive to actuation of the torque generation component.

Image processing apparatus, operating method of image processing apparatus, and computer-readable recording medium

An image processing apparatus includes a processor including hardware, the processor being configured to: estimate, based on image information from a medical device that includes at least an endoscope, a plurality of procedure actions of an operator of the endoscope; perform different supports respectively for procedures by the operator, according to an estimation result of the procedure actions; and output a display for the supports to a display.
